One of the key advancements anticipated in sunroof assembly lines is the integration of automated robotics. Automation is not a new concept in manufacturing, but its application within specific components, like sunroofs, has been gradually evolving. By 2025, we expect to see a broader implementation of advanced robotic systems capable of performing intricate tasks, such as precisely sealing and aligning sunroof components. This not only reduces human error but also increases production speeds, addressing the growing consumer demand for faster delivery times.
Furthermore, the utilization of artificial intelligence (AI) in the assembly process is on the horizon. AI-driven machines are expected to monitor the quality of sunroof components in real-time, utilizing sophisticated algorithms to detect defects much earlier in the assembly process. This proactive approach not only reduces waste but ensures that only the highest quality products make it to the consumer, further enhancing brand reputation.
Sustainability remains a driving force in modern manufacturing, and sunroof production is no exception. In the coming years, we will see a surge in the use of eco-friendly materials within sunroof components. Manufacturers are increasingly focusing on sourcing sustainable materials, such as recycled plastics and bio-based composites, reducing the carbon footprint associated with production. By aligning with environmentally conscious practices, companies not only appeal to eco-aware consumers but also comply with increasing regulations surrounding manufacturing sustainability.
The digital twin technology, which allows manufacturers to create virtual models of their production processes, is gaining traction. By implementing digital twins in the sunroof assembly line, manufacturers can simulate and optimize workflows, predict maintenance needs, and troubleshoot issues before they occur. This technology is expected to lead to significant cost savings and improved efficiency, marking a pivotal shift in traditional manufacturing methodologies.

Another emerging trend is the implementation of IoT (Internet of Things) in assembly lines. With interconnected machinery, real-time data collection can provide insights into machinery performance and assembly efficiency. For sunroof assembly lines, this means improved tracking of production metrics, allowing for more informed decision-making and continuous improvement processes that significantly enhance overall productivity.
Moreover, as consumer preferences shift towards more advanced features and functionalities, sunroofs are evolving to meet these demands. Features like panoramic sunroofs, solar-powered sunroofs, and integrated smart technology are becoming increasingly popular. Innovations in the production line will need to accommodate these advancements, ensuring that manufacturers can keep pace with the changing market landscape.
